Legislation Changes to General Skilled Migration

General Skilled Migration Amendments

26 April 2008 - Legislation Change Client summary

From 26 April 2008, the Migration Regulations 1994 ('the Regulations') are amended to give full effect to the policy intention of the General Skilled Migration reforms which commenced on 1 September 2007. The majority of the amendments are minor technical amendments to ensure consistency across the Regulations. Other changes include correcting some errors and ensuring that all provisions operate as were originally intended.
Affected legislation

The following provisions of the Regulations are amended:

Part 1 of the Regulations
Part 2 of the Regulations
Schedule 1 to the Regulations
Schedule 2 to the Regulations
Schedule 6B of the Regulations

Additional information: Nil

Transitional provisions: The amendments apply in relation to an application for a visa made but not finally determined before, or made on or after, 26 April 2008.
